Reworks the chat and session-sidebar render paths to cut render cascades, memory
churn, and UI jank on large sessions and big session trees. Behavior is preserved;
the changes are about *when* and *how much* the UI re-renders.
## Chat streaming
- Freeze the streaming message's parts in the bulk turn projection during streaming,
and re-inject live parts only in an isolated tail leaf, so a ~60/sec delta stream
no longer re-runs the whole-session projection or re-renders unrelated rows.

- Memoize message rows with field-aware comparators instead of reference equality.
- Replace the manual child-session polling in the task tool with the live SSE
stream + a one-shot load, removing a fetch/settle state machine.
## History loading & scroll
- Load an initial page fast, then prepend one older page in the background so the
scroll container has headroom and "load older on scroll-up" fires before the user
hits the absolute top.
- Compensate scroll synchronously (in a layout effect, before paint) for prepends —
including background prepends that don't originate from a user scroll — so the
viewport stays stable instead of judder-correcting on the next frame.
## Markdown rendering
- Render markdown synchronously *styled* on first paint (paragraphs, lists, code
cards, tables, inline code) instead of raw escaped text; the async pass then only
upgrades syntax-highlight colors. Eliminates the flash of full-width raw text.
- Load KaTeX CSS eagerly with the main bundle instead of inside the lazy markdown
chunk, avoiding a late stylesheet injection on first render.
## Sidebar
- Hoist per-row recursive tree walks out of row comparators into per-group
precomputed sets/keys; batch live-session lookups into a single map; add a
group-level memo boundary.
- Isolate rename drafts so per-keystroke typing doesn't repaint the row tree.
## Sync layer
- Add a staleness guard so a slow message fetch can't repopulate a session the user
navigated away from.
- Throw on fetch failure for authoritative loaders so a transient blip can't read as
an empty server response.
## Cleanup
- Remove dead code (unused hooks, params, duplicated inline types) surfaced while
reworking the above.
## Known issue
- A rare, purely cosmetic first-paint width flash can still appear on large sessions;
it has no behavioral or data impact and is tracked for a follow-up runtime trace.
